Since I changed my trolling batteries to Optima D34M's, I've been looking for a better battery tray. The one I have is the standard dual-27 tray with the plastic clips on the nylon straps. Even though the Optimas slop around in it a bit, they are pretty snug with the straps cinched down.
Still, I'd prefer a battery tray made specifically for 34's, but everything I find online is some gimmicky billet aluminum crap for tuner car owners looking to power their stereos...hideously expensive too. Have any of you boat gurus seen anything decent and fairly inexpensive for 34's? By the way...I am totally stoked about the new MarinCo (Guest) charge on the run system for 24V setups...that is going to really extend my trolling motor use. I actually ran my batteries down last weekend with CMorg to where my troller was clearly running slower.
